Output 4e4db6bc04d5ce9033f2158c7199c0e95b91f9df3bb80bcd1b2fc92bb6fef84f:1

value
1020536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d531e861583d691e63b907741f94be938205180 OP_EQUAL
address
34N56LEXRyNT1eepitJTk9EFkZYHnFTrZh
transaction
4e4db6bc04d5ce9033f2158c7199c0e95b91f9df3bb80bcd1b2fc92bb6fef84f
confirmations
339819
spent
true